Motorcycles have clutches, and life is full of sorrows and joys. "Four Seas" focuses on the growth of Wu Renyao, who regards motorcycles as his only friend, and also pays attention to his life clutches and sorrows.

"Four Seas" is the fourth film directed by Han Han. From "After Forever", "Ride the Wind and Waves" to "Flying Life", and then to this "Four Seas", Han Han's unique directing style is more obvious. If the last "Flying Life" is about the counterattack of middle-aged people after the decadence, then "Four Seas" focuses on the setbacks and growth encountered by young people in their dreams. Some are wild, some are sad and some are warm, while focusing on the loneliness and powerlessness of young people who are running around the world, they also express their persistence and perseverance in burning youth because of their dreams. The result may not be satisfactory, but the process is always imprinted in people's hearts and makes people see it very empathetically.

The protagonist of the film is the teenager Ah Yao, a hot-blooded rider who specializes in motorcycle stunts living on Nan'ao Island. The reunion with his father Wu Renteng and the chance encounter with the girl Zhou Huansong changed the trajectory of Ah Yao's life and also changed his life return. Since then, he has also opened his own path to brave the world.

The comedic effect of "Four Seas" is still very sufficient. Wu Renyao, played by Liu Haoran, and Wu Renteng, played by Shen Teng, are father and son, but they are also "enemies". The scene of the two meeting and hating each other creates a lot of laughter for the film. In particular, Shen Teng, as soon as he appeared on the scene, he brought his own laughing fruit, and every time he could make people laugh to the point of sobbing. The process of reconciliation between Wu Renyao and Wu Renteng's father and son, although there are only a few shots, is full of the power of family affection, which also makes people feel warm. Yin Zheng, who starred in Zhou Huan's brother Zhou Huange, also has his own sense of comedy and is also the comedy of the film. Wang Yanlin, Qiao Shan, Feng Shaofeng, and Huang Xiaoming were also full of joy, and they all created a very brilliant sense of laughter in the process of tearing each other apart and fighting each other. Han Han is really good at selecting actors, not only so that Liu Haoran, Shen Teng, Yin Zheng, Wang Yanlin, Qiao Shan, Feng Shaofeng, Huang Xiaoming and other people have no sense of violation in the film, but also let them two or two CP are very good, flowing between them family, friendship, brotherhood, both real and warm.

The matching degree between Liu Haoran and Wu Renyao in "Four Seas" is very high, Liu Haoran not only performed Wu Renyao's sense of youth, but also grasped the innocence and shyness when encountering love, and the confusion and tenacity when encountering difficulties. In particular, the energy that was unwilling to give up obsession for the sake of dreams was soaked in Wu Renyao's fierce eyes. The transition from ignorant teenagers to hot-blooded youths has also been interpreted by Liu Haoran with a great sense of layering. Wu Renyao's uninhibited, wild and wild when riding a motorcycle on the race is in stark contrast to the warmth, delicacy and affection after falling in love, and the three-dimensional sense and fullness of the character suddenly jumped on the screen. The improvement and progress of Liu Haoran's acting skills is visible to the naked eye.

There are several motorcycle chase scenes in "Four Seas" that are filmed with great feeling. Han Han is worthy of being a director who is very good at playing with cars, and he has a lot of experience in shooting such scenes, and he has made tricks. The chase scene between the police and Wu Renyao, the picture of Wu Renyao suddenly stopping in front of a car of steel bars while speeding, was filmed with a great sense of urgency, and the visual irritation made people dare not see the atmosphere, and there was a sense of suffocation of speed and passion in an instant. The scene of the motorcyclist race is very exciting and wild, and there is a feeling that hormones are burning and adrenaline is boiling. The roar, the rushing dust, the sparks from the helmet and the curb, the scene of the extremely fast speed car made people watch the great pleasure, and people could not help but sigh secretly: it is worthy of Han Han's hand.
